Boeing named Pat Shanahan as vice president and general manager of the 787 program, succeeding Mike Bair, who will become vice president of business strategy and marketing for commercial airplanes, both effective immediately.
Shanahan was earlier vice president, missile defense systems at Boeing Integrated Defense Systems, the company said in a statement.
On Oct. 10, the company said it had pushed back the first deliveries of its 787 Dreamliner by at least six months, citing difficulties in assembling the new lightweight carbon-composite planes.
